Standard Model Higgs boson production and hard photon radiation in e+e- μ+μ- b bγ events at LEP II and Next Linear Collider
Stefano Moretti
Abstract
We study at LEP II and Next Linear Collider energies Higgs production via the bremsstrahlung channel e+e- ZH, with Z μ+μ- and H b b, and the corresponding irreducible background, in presence of hard photon radiation, both from the initial and the final state. We carry out an analysis that includes the computation of all the relevant contributions to the complete tree--level matrix element for e+e- μ+μ- b bγ and makes use of the one at leading order e+e- μ+μ- b b interfaced with electron structure functions. We concentrate on the case of mass degeneracy MH≈ MZ, for which next--to--leading electromagnetic contributions can modify the content of b b--pairs coming from H and Z decays. A brief discussion concerning the case MH≈ MZ is also given.
